Cost of senior care in Camden, NJ

Assisted living in Camden, NJ averages $7,315 per month — about 37% above the national median. In-home care runs about $34 per hour, or roughly $5,440 per month for full-time help.

Senior care costs in Camden, NJ
Care typeTypical costNotes
In-home care$34/hour~$5,440/mo full-time
Assisted living$7,315/monthprivate one-bedroom
Nursing home$14,235/month~$170,820/yr, private room

Source: CareScout / Genworth Cost of Care Survey (2024).

Does Medicaid help pay for senior care in NJ?

Yes. NJ's Medicaid program offers waivers that can help cover home care and, in some cases, assisted living for residents who meet income and care-need rules. Eligibility and covered services vary, so confirm the details with the state program.
